Porsche Penske Unveils Retro Liveries for Road America Endurance Race

Porsche Penske Motorsport has announced that its cars will compete in the upcoming IMSA SportsCar Championship event at Road America featuring special heritage-inspired paint schemes. This exciting reveal comes as the team prepares for one of the season's most anticipated races, where two historic designs will take to the track.
The #6 Porsche 963 LMDh, piloted by Kevin Estre and Laurens Vanthoor, will showcase the striking blue and yellow Sunoco livery, a design that became legendary with the Porsche 917/30 during the 1970s. Concurrently, Julien Andlauer and Felipe Nasr, driving the #7 Porsche 963, will revive the vibrant yellow color scheme synonymous with the Porsche RS Spyder LMP2. This marks the fourth instance this season where Porsche Penske has adorned its LMDh prototypes with unique liveries, previously doing so at Sebring, Long Beach, and Laguna Seca. The year 2026 holds special significance, commemorating Porsche's 75th anniversary in motorsport and Team Penske's 60th year since its inception. To honor these milestones, and with the Road America event extended to a six-hour format, the team strategically chose this race to celebrate two of the most triumphant vehicles in their collaborative history.
Thomas Laudenbach, Vice President of Porsche Motorsport, reflected on the historical ties to Road America, noting the Porsche 917/30's dominant performance in 1973, when Mark Donohue set a record-breaking lap. He also recalled the RS Spyder's successful return to prototype racing in 2006, highlighting its overall victory at the 2008 Sebring 12 Hours against more powerful LMP1 competitors. Roger Penske, founder of Penske Corporation, emphasized the deep-rooted partnership between Team Penske and Porsche, describing it as one of racing's most enduring and successful relationships. These special liveries serve as a tribute not only to championship-winning eras and legendary cars but also to the individuals whose contributions forged their collective success. The Porsche 917/30's dominance in the Can-Am Series and the RS Spyder's remarkable achievements in LMP2 racing, including multiple American Le Mans Series titles and Le Mans class victories, underscore the rich legacy being celebrated.
